COVID-19 Research
The Severe acute respiratory syndrome coronavirus-2 (SARS-CoV-2) causes the COVID-19 respiratory disease. SARS-CoV-2 is highly contagious and transmits predominantly via the respiratory route. It is an enveloped virus with a single-stranded RNA genome. Small molecules can be used to investigate the virus and the corresponding immune response.
